The St. James Sharks return fewer starters, but more players overall for 2008. That suits Coach Billy Hurston just fine.
St. James, as a school, increased its enrollment by almost 50% over the past calendar year. The turnout for the football team has had the same increase. Hurston says he’s had 96 players come out this year, while last season he had just 63.
But the Sharks have lost some key players - most notably QB Skylar Brown and RBs Ingram Bell and Brandon Tyson. But what St. James has lost in quality, they’ve gained in quantity. For the first time in school history, the team will enter the season will 11 different starters on offense and defense. As for Brown’s replacement, Hurston is excited about sophomore QB Chase Smith, who has good height and athleticism and may evolve into a very good quarterback in time at St. James.
